An equity income annuity is different from its annuity counterparts because it is closely tied to a specific equity market, often the S&P 500.
By pairing itself with this market, the annuity will offer additional interest to its investors based on the performance of the agreed-upon market.
For example, if the annuity is tied to the S&P 500 and this market performs well quarter after quarter, the annuity will enjoy a higher rate of interest each quarter.
The interest will be put into the initial investment and since the annuity is tax-deferred, the investment will continue to grow at an aggressive rate.
This additional interest will compound and expand the investor's initial principle over time.
But what if the market struggles? Can the investor lose their investment during these lean times in the marketplace? Not at all.
In fact, every equity annuity guarantees a minimum interest rate so that even when the market is dropping significantly, the annuity investment will still see a gain, albeit a slower growth than if the market was performing better.
Regardless, the annuity investment continues to grow over this time.
